Key Features: Includes heater with two angle brackets and LP conversion kit; thermostat, hose, and regulator not included. Dimensions 29.33” L x 15.50” W x 26.37” H. Rated 80,000 BTU and designed for natural gas. Coverage roughly for up to 2,000 sq. ft. Electrical spec: 120 V, 2.3 amps. Venting: Category 1 vertical or category 3 horizontal.

This unit is a compact-format ceiling or wall-mounted unit heater intended for larger small garages and workshops that require higher BTU output. Installation requires maintaining at least 8 ft. clearance from floor to base of unit for safe operation and proper airflow. The package includes basic mounting brackets but excludes thermostat and gas hookups, so professional installation is commonly recommended for compliance and safe venting.

Key Features: Natural gas ready (no fuel conversion). Uses infrared technology to radiate heat to objects and people rather than only heating air. Rated at 30,000 BTU for coverage up to about 1,000 sq. ft.

Buying Guide: How To Choose A Small Natural Gas Garage Heater

Space Size And BTU Needs: Calculate your garage or workshop volume and insulation level. As a rule of thumb, lightly insulated spaces need roughly 40–60 BTU per square foot to maintain comfortable temperature; better insulated spaces need less. For small single-car garages, units in the 10,000–30,000 BTU range are often adequate. For larger or poorly insulated spaces, consider 45,000 BTU or higher.

Vented vs Ventless: Direct vent and unit heaters expel combustion gases outdoors, improving indoor air quality. Ventless (blue flame) models maximize heat output without external venting but release combustion byproducts indoors and may be restricted by code. Check local regulations and ventilation requirements before choosing a ventless model.

Heat Delivery Type: Infrared heaters warm objects and people directly and perform well in drafty spaces or where doors open frequently. Forced air unit heaters distribute warm air throughout the garage and can be more comfortable for general heating. Choose infrared for targeted warmth and forced air for whole-room circulation.

Mounting And Footprint: Wall-mounted models save floor space; ceiling-mounted unit heaters free wall space and can distribute heat over a larger area. Verify mounting hardware and clearances. Compact wall units often fit under shelves or above workbenches; ceiling units require suspended mounting points and attention to airflow around fixtures.

Installation Requirements: Natural gas supply line size and pressure must meet appliance requirements. Some units include conversion kits for LP, while others prohibit fuel conversion. Electrical requirements vary—some heaters need only a pilot while others require 120 V power for fans or controls. Consider professional installation for gas connections and venting to ensure safety and code compliance.

Safety Features: Look for sealed combustion, oxygen depletion sensors, safety pilots, and overheat protection. Direct vent models with sealed combustion are recommended where indoor air quality is a priority. Ventless models require good ventilation and adherence to local rules. Install carbon monoxide detectors in any occupied space using gas appliances.

Thermostat And Controls: Built-in thermostats allow local temperature control; compatibility with external or programmable thermostats can improve efficiency and comfort. Consider units that support thermostatic control if you want automated temperature regulation and reduced fuel use.

Efficiency And Operating Modes: Higher thermal efficiency reduces fuel consumption for a given heat output. Some units offer multi-stage firing (high/low) to match demand and improve efficiency. Compare efficiency figures or staged output to determine the best match for variable conditions.

Noise And Air Movement: Forced-air units use fans that create low-level noise and air movement. Infrared and blue-flame models are generally quieter. If the garage doubles as a workspace, evaluate noise levels and choose units with low-static fans or quieter operation if noise is a concern.

Compliance And Local Codes: Always confirm local building codes, fuel appliance restrictions, and venting rules before purchase. Some municipalities limit ventless appliances or require specific clearances and vent materials. Obtaining permits and using licensed HVAC professionals for installation ensures safety and compliance.

Maintenance And Longevity: Regular maintenance includes filter cleaning (if applicable), checking vent integrity, inspecting burners and pilots, and annual professional service. Consider availability of replacement parts, service manuals, and brand support when evaluating long-term ownership.

Comparison Perspectives:

  • Small Single-Car Garage: Consider direct vent wall heaters or compact ventless units for footprint constraints; prioritize sealed combustion if possible.
  • Two-Car Garage / Large Workshop: Mid-range unit heaters (30k–45k BTU) or ceiling-mounted units distribute heat more effectively across larger volumes.
  • Drafty Spaces / Frequent Door Openings: Infrared heaters provide faster perceived warmth to people and work surfaces and are often more efficient in these conditions.
  • Minimal Installation Complexity: Ventless models reduce venting work but may be restricted by code; direct vent models require exterior wall or roof penetrations but offer cleaner indoor air.

Final Selection Tips: Match BTU capacity to insulation and square footage, confirm venting type against local code, choose the heat delivery method that fits your usage pattern (infrared vs forced air vs blue flame), and plan for professional installation when gas lines or venting modifications are required.
